Consulte PageHelper-Spring-Boot, que es muy conveniente de usar. Para obtener más PageHelper, puede hacer clic en https://github.com/pagehelper/mybatis-pagehelper.
Cuando Spring Boot integra mybatis, primero debemos paginarlo.
<Spendency> <MoupRid> com.github.pagehelper </groupid> <artifactid> pageHelper </arfactid> <versión> 5.1.2 </versión> </pendency> <epardency> <MoupRoMID> com.github.pagehelper </proupid> <shifactid> pagehelper-spring-boot-auToconfigure </Artifact> </artifact> <Versión> 1.2.3 </versión> </pendency> <pendency> <proupid> com.github.pagehelper </groupid> <artifactid> pagehelper-spring-boot-starter </artifactid> <versión> 1.2.3 </versión> </pendency>
Método 1: lo agregamos en Application.yml (YML que debe leerse en primavera)
PageHelper: helperdialect: mysql razonable: verdadero soporte de soporteMethodSarGuments: verdaderos parámetros: count = countsql
Luego reinicie.
Java eventualmente lo leerá el archivo de configuración y se inyectará en el bean de primavera. Por lo tanto, nuestro segundo método es configurar su clase de frijoles. La carga en caliente es fácil de modificar. Por supuesto, el método es más simple.
Método 2: cree un nuevo PageHelePerconfig en el paquete de cobertura de anotación
import com.github.pagehelper.pagehelper; import java.util.properties; import org.springframework.context.annotation.bean; import org.springframework.context.annotation.configuration;/** * @author zhuxiaomeng * @Date 2018/1/2. * @EMAIL [email protected] */ @ConfigurationPublic PageHelPonCig {@Bean public PageHelper getPageHelper () {PageHelper PageHelper = new PageHelper (); Propiedades Propiedades = New Properties (); Properties.setProperty ("helperdialect", "mysql"); Properties.setProperty ("razonable", "verdadero"); Properties.setProperty ("SoportMethodSarGuments", "verdadero"); Properties.setProperty ("params", "count = countSql"); PageHelper.SetProperties (Propiedades); devolver PageHelper; }}
El conocimiento básico de PageHelper es:
import com.github.pagehelper.page; import com.github.pagehelper.pagehelper;
Página <T> tpage = pageHelper.StartPage (página, límite);
La siguiente declaración de consulta se usa para paginar. Solo necesita recibirlo con la lista <t>
Si tiene preguntas, puede descargar el proyecto de código abierto Lenos para desarrollar rápidamente andamios, y la versión Spring Boot está familiarizada con el aprendizaje.
Dirección: https://gitee.com/bweird/lenosp
Lo anterior es todo el contenido de este artículo. Espero que sea útil para el aprendizaje de todos y espero que todos apoyen más a Wulin.com.